Tales of a City are Recruiting Volunteers…
Tales of a City Tours are recruiting volunteers! For those who don’t know, Tales of a City Tours offers a unique perspective on the city of Leeds, through cultural walking tours that are designed and led by refugees. Following the popularity of our Act435.org.uk post we thought we’d post all the Grant makers we know about in one post. Search for grants www.turn2us.org.uk This website provides information on benefit entitlement and other grant giving charities. www.disability-grants.org This website provides information on charities that provide grants for disabled people.
